Transaction 62b41d374c1983d9739497155b9fa6ee0a4bd2745f5a002c9231e70e31d19d29

2 Input
3 Outputs
  • 62b41d374c1983d9739497155b9fa6ee0a4bd2745f5a002c9231e70e31d19d29:0
  • value  170000000
    address  1LRLHuKdk2Tb7t3RZywDz2ZibsFDfgX5gX
  • 62b41d374c1983d9739497155b9fa6ee0a4bd2745f5a002c9231e70e31d19d29:1
  • value  112029409
    address  1B4cP5DYcPhR5e9HeBkf1rTcSKA9SzzuAK
  • 62b41d374c1983d9739497155b9fa6ee0a4bd2745f5a002c9231e70e31d19d29:2
  • value  24814
    address  129SJAy5Ar21G96W4XA2L8231jQixBjx2F